AN ACT
To prohibit the Secretary of the Treasury from engaging in transactions
involving the exchange of Special Drawing Rights issued by the
International Monetary Fund that are held by the Russian Federation or
Belarus.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the ``Russia and Belarus SDR Exchange
Prohibition Act of 2022''.
SEC. 2. SPECIAL DRAWING RIGHTS EXCHANGE PROHIBITION.
(a) In General.--The Secretary of the Treasury may not engage in
any transaction involving the exchange of Special Drawing Rights issued
by the International Monetary Fund that are held by the Russian
Federation or Belarus.
(b) Advocacy.--The Secretary of the Treasury shall--
(1) vigorously advocate that the governments of the member
countries of the International Monetary Fund, to the extent
that the member countries issue freely usable currencies,
prohibit transactions involving the exchange of Special Drawing
Rights held by the Russian Federation or Belarus and
(2) direct the United States Executive Director at each
international financial institution (as defined in section
1701(c)(2) of the International Financial Institutions Act) to
use the voice and vote of the United States to oppose the
provision of financial assistance to the Russian Federation and
Belarus, except to address basic human needs of the civilian
population.
(c) Termination.--The preceding provisions of this section shall
have no force or effect on the earlier of--
(1) the date that is 5 years after the date of the
enactment of this Act; or
(2) 30 days after the date that the President reports to
the Congress that the governments of the Russian Federation and
Belarus have ceased destabilizing activities with respect to
the sovereignty and territorial integrity of Ukraine.
(d) Waiver.--The President may waive the application of this
section if the President reports to the Congress that the waiver is in
the national interest of the United States and includes an explanation
of the reasons therefor.
